What does frost work mean?
Frost work means Any naturally occurring intricate pattern of ice crystals..

Frostwork keeps its place on the window within three feet of the stove all day in my chamber.
More delicate frostwork, this time in the form of hairlike needles of calcite, occurs near the Pearly Gates. Here, as in all caves under the jurisdiction of the National Park Service, you are asked not to touch or handle the cave formations.
